It uses periodically operated analog switches together with capacitors and operational amplifiers. These components are available in today standard MOS and CMOS VLSI technologies and are, therefore, fully compatible with digital circuits. The technique provides not only sensor interfacing and signal amplification but it offers posibility to cancel offset and cross-sensitivity as well.
